VIN Number Breakdown

The World Manufacturer Identifier, Vehicle Descriptor Section, and Vehicle Identifier Section are the three groupings of the 17 numbers and letters (17 places) that make up a VIN. To enable you to decode any VIN number, we will go over each of the 17 locations here. You’ll master VIN decoding in no time!

Position 1

You can find out where in the globe your car was built by looking at the first letter or number of the VIN. To determine where in the globe your VIN was created, compare the letter or number below to the initial number or letter of your VIN.

Africa is where items A through H are manufactured. Asia is where J, K, L, M, N, P, and R are produced. Europe is where S, T, U, V, W, X, Y, and Z are produced. The first five are produced in North America. Oceania produced numbers 6 and 7. 8 and 9 were produced in South America.

Position 2

The second letter or number in the VIN, when combined with the first letter or number, identifies the nation where the car or truck was built. Do Honda hybrids require pricey maintenance?

Does maintaining a hybrid vehicle cost more than maintaining a standard gasoline-powered vehicle? No, unless when it malfunctions, of course. Regular upkeep and minor repairs for a hybrid vehicle are typically no more expensive than for a conventional vehicle. In reality, they might even be lower. However, you might have to pay a lot of money if something goes wrong with the hybrid system of the automobile after the warranty has run out.

Customers question whether the improved gas mileage of hybrids actually saves them money because they are more expensive upfront than normal automobiles of comparable size. The answer relies on a number of variables, including gas prices, how frequently you drive, and how long you retain the automobile.

Typically, maintenance expenditures shouldn’t be considered heavily in the financial calculations. A hybrid’s gasoline engine needs the same upkeep as any other car’s. Early hybrid owners were forced to go to dealerships, which are occasionally more expensive, because few repair shops were willing to work on them. More mechanics are qualified and ready to work on hybrid vehicles today.

A hybrid car may require less regular maintenance than a conventional vehicle. When the car is stationary or moving at low speeds, the gas engine shuts off and the electric motor takes over. This implies that the engine experiences less deterioration. Oil changes are advised at 5,000 miles (8,046 kilometers) rather than the 3,000 miles (4,828 kilometers) that mechanics advise for many comparable automobiles on smaller hybrids in particular.

Because of the hybrids’ regenerative braking mechanism and the reduced heat generated, brakes and brake pads typically last significantly longer.

The majority of hybrid vehicles don’t require any extra routine maintenance on the hybrid system. The Ford Escape hybrid is an exception, as its electric battery system’s air filter needs to be changed every 40,000 to 50,000 miles (64,373 to 80,437 kilometers).

However, there is always a chance that a specific hybrid system component, most frequently the huge battery pack, will malfunction. The typical warranty on a hybrid system for a vehicle sold today is eight years or one hundred thousand miles (160,934 kilometers) (241,402 kilometers). However, the expenditures might be astronomical if you’re unlucky and your car’s hybrid battery fails after you’ve reached those milestones. The price of a replacement hybrid battery has decreased for the most part, which is fantastic news. Early hybrid vehicles’ batteries might cost up to $8,000 at the time. Currently, budget for slightly over $2,000 today.

What hybrid vehicle is the most dependable?

Hybrid vehicles are excellent for both financial and environmental savings. An electric motor plus a gasoline or diesel engine make up a standard hybrid. The car can be driven by either powerplant, and in some cases they will cooperate for increased efficiency. Everything depends on the type of hybrid and the driving circumstances. Each of the three hybrid varieties has distinct advantages and performs well in particular circumstances.

Full hybrids

During accelerating, stopping, and even coasting, a full hybrid vehicle’s batteries are recharged using generators and a regenerative braking system. The electric motor or motors that typically operate during acceleration or low speeds are powered by the battery while charging, which dramatically lowers fuel usage.

Mild hybrids

The balance between low cost and good efficiency is excellent with mild hybrids. Mild hybrid battery packs are smaller and recharge similarly to complete hybrid battery packs. Since electric motors are less powerful than internal combustion engines, a mild hybrid cannot be driven solely on electricity. Instead, the motor functions as a power source alongside the internal combustion engine. Mild hybrid systems often activate during acceleration, relieving part of the load on the traditional engine.

Plug-in hybrids

The car that comes closest to becoming totally electric is a plug-in hybrid (PHEV). It has a traditional engine and an electric motor with autonomous operation. A plug-in hybrid can be charged at home or in charging stations, and a full charge provides 20 to 50 miles of all-electric driving. The traditional engine can also be used to charge the battery, however because to the significant fuel consumption, this method is frequently ineffective.
